CorrespondenceHildebrandGurlitt CulturalPlunderbytheEinsatzstabReichsleiterRosenberg:DatabaseofArtObjectsattheJeude Paume Database“CentralCollectingPointMünchen“ Database“KunstsammlungHermannGöring” GettyProvenanceIndex,GermanSalesCatalogs Lootedart.com LostArt RépertoiredesBiensSpoliés RijksbureauvoorKunsthistorischeDocumentatie VerzeichnisnationalwertvollerKunstwerke(“Reichslistevon1938”) WittLibrary Note: ThisworkwasoriginallyownedbyEugèneBlot(1857Paris–1938Paris),aParisiandealer,bronze founder and art collector. It was offered for sale at the Vente Blot in 1933 but was bought in, accordingtotheauctionrecordspreservedattheArchivesdeParis. Thepossibleprovenancethatwastentativelyassignedtotheartworkinthecourseofitsseizure, andlaterpublishedonLostart.de,requiresfurtherresearch. 11September2015(interimresults) www.lostart.de/EN/Fund/478404 ©TaskForceSchwabingArtTrove ObjectrecordexcerptforLostArtID:478404 Disclaimer: TheresearchoftheTaskforceSchwabingArtTrovefocusedexclusivelyontheprovenanceofthe artworkdescribedinthisreport.Thisreportdoesnotpurporttomakepronouncementsonany legalclaimsandlegalpositions.TheheadoftheTaskforceSchwabingArtTroveisresponsiblefor thecontentsandthepublicationofthisreport.
